Grant and Rob do their very best to not give too much time to Angel One, a frankly sexist episode that rolls out every cliché from the first season of TNG. But there’s much more to discuss in terms of the production of Star Trek, and the progress the early show is making.
Riker shows off the proposed Season 2 uniforms
Episode synopsis: While Riker leads an away team to a female-dominated planet, a mysterious virus spreads among the Enterprise crew. Originally broadcast in the USA on 25th January 1988.
Quote: “Thank you. Actually, it feels quite comfortable.”
Score: 2
